Notice Prohibiting the Taking of Mussels from Ohiwa Harbour
(Notice No. 3169; Ag. 9/2/0/2)
PURSUANT to section 85 of the Fisheries Act 1983, I hereby declare
a closed season for Ohiwa Harbour in respect of mussels over a
term commencing on the date of publication of this notice and
ending with the 31st day of March 1986.
Dated at Wellington this 16th day of December 1983.

Notice Declaring Category A and Category B Fish Diseases
(Notice No. 3172; Ag. 9/2/0/2)
PURSUANT to regulation 26 of the Freshwater Fish Farming
Regulations 1983, I hereby declare Category A and Category B fish
diseases as follows:
CATEGORY A
The viral diseases—
Infectious haematopoietic necrosis (IHN)
Infectious pancreatic necrosis (IPN)
Spring viremia of carp (SVC)
Viral haemorrhagic septicaemia (VHS)
The bacterial diseases—
Enteric redmouth disease (ERM)
Kidney disease
Nocardial disease
Piscine tuberculosis
The sporozoan parasite—
Myxosoma cerebralis
The fungus infection—
Ichthyophonus
CATEGORY B
Aeromonas and Pseudomonas septicaemia
Carp erythrodermatitis (CE)
Costia
Myxobacterial disease—Columnaris, fin rot, and gill disease Vibriosis
Dated at Wellington this 17th day of January 1984.

Notice Fixing Payments to North and South Island Councils of
Acclimatisation Societies (Notice No. 3173; Ag. 9/2/0/2)
PURSUANT to regulation 18 of the Freshwater Fisheries Regulations
1983, I hereby declare that the sum payable by each acclimatisation
society to its Island Council in respect of each licence issued by it
shall be as follows:
Adult whole season licence . . $4.00
Junior whole season licence . . $1.00
Adult weekly licence . . $2.00
Adult day licence . . $1.00
Junior day licence . . Nil
Dated at Wellington this 17th day of January 1984.

Notice Imposing Surcharges on Freshwater Fisheries Licence Fees
(Notice No. 3174; Ag. 9/2/0/2)
PURSUANT to regulation 17 of the Freshwater Fisheries Regulations
1983, I hereby impose a surcharge on licence fees as follows:
Adult whole season licence . . $4.00
Junior whole season licence . . $1.00
Adult weekly licence . . $2.00
Adult day licence . . $1.00
Junior day licence . . Nil
Dated at Wellington this 17th day of January 1984.

Notice Specifying Fish Species Which May be Farmed (Notice
No. 3175; Ag. 9/2/0/2)
PURSUANT to regulation 2 of the Freshwater Fish Farming
Regulations 1983, I hereby declare the following species to be fish
for the purposes of those regulations:
(a) Salmon, being—
(i) Atlantic salmon (Salmo salar):
(ii) Quinnat salmon (Oncorhynchus tshawytscha):
(iii) Sockeye salmon (Oncorhynchus nerka):
(b) Eels (Anguilla dieffenbachii and Anguilla australis):
(c) Freshwater crayfish or koura (Paranephrops planifrons and
Paranephrops zealandicus):
(d) Spiny or red rock lobster (Jasus edwardsii), and packhorse or
green rock lobster (Jasus verreauxi).
Dated at Wellington this 17th day of January 1984.

The Water Recreation (Upper Clutha River) Notice 1984
I, Beryl Ann Ranger, Senior Executive Officer (Harbours and
Foreshores), pursuant to the Water Recreation Regulations 1979*
and in exercise of powers delegated to me pursuant to sections 8
and 9 of the Ministry of Transport Act 1968, hereby give the
following notice:
NOTICE
-
(a) This notice may be cited as the Water Recreation (Upper
Clutha River) Notice 1984.
(b) This notice shall come into force 14 days after its publication
in the New Zealand Gazette and shall remain in force until revoked
by further notice in the Gazette. -
Subject to the conditions set forth in the Second Schedule hereto,
regulations 7 (1) (a), 7 (1) (b), and 7 (2) of the Water Recreation
Regulations 1979 shall not apply to those areas as specified in the
First Schedule between the hours of 10 a.m. and 4 p.m. extending
to 6 p.m. during New Zealand Daylight time.
FIRST SCHEDULE
ALL the waters of the Upper Clutha River situated in Blocks 4, 5,
and 11 Lower Wanaka Survey District and Blocks 6, 7, and 8, Lower
Hawea Survey District, from the county boundary between Lake
and Vincent Counties near Lake Wanaka outlet, downstream to the
road bridge crossing the Clutha River north of Luggate. The above
area is more particularly shown on plan MD 16214 deposited in
the office of the Secretary for Transport at Wellington.
SECOND SCHEDULE
-
Notwithstanding any other provision of this notice, no person
who is permitted by any such provision to propel or navigate a
small craft at a speed through the water exceeding 5 knots shall do
so in any manner that is likely to endanger or unduly annoy any
person who is in, on, or using the waters, or fishing, or undertaking
any recreational activity in the vicinity of the small craft. -
That all craft exceeding 5 knots when approaching fishermen
keep as far as possible to the centre of the river so as to cause the
minimum of disturbance to fishermen on the banks. -
All persons in charge of a vessel shall adhere to and keep the
provisions of all other Acts and regulations not specifically exempted
by this notice. -
A suitable notice as may be approved by the Regional Marine
Officer, Ministry of Transport, Christchurch, shall be erected at sites
deemed necessary by the Regional Marine Officer.
